What are High Speed Motor Journal Bearings?
High speed motor journal bearings are critical components that support the rotor of high-speed electric motors. They allow smooth rotation while minimizing friction and wear. Understanding the differences between standard and advanced performance models can help in selecting the right bearing for specific applications.

1. What is the main difference between standard and advanced performance high speed motor journal bearings?
The primary difference lies in their design and materials. Advanced performance bearings utilize superior materials and advanced engineering techniques to offer better load handling, reduced friction, and improved thermal stability compared to standard bearings.
2. What are the advantages of using advanced performance high speed motor journal bearings?
- Increased Load Capacity: Advanced bearings can handle higher loads without deforming, making them suitable for demanding applications.
- Reduced Friction: These bearings have smoother surfaces and improved designs, leading to lower friction losses and higher efficiency.
- Better Heat Dissipation: Advanced materials allow for better heat management, which prolongs the life of the motor.
- Enhanced Durability: They are more resistant to wear and tear, reducing maintenance needs and downtime.

4. How do you select the right high speed motor journal bearing?
Selecting the right high speed motor journal bearing involves several factors:
- Operating Speed: Ensure the bearing can sustain the maximum speed of the motor.
- Load Requirements: Consider both static and dynamic load capacities when making a selection.
- Temperature Range: Check if the bearing can operate efficiently within the expected temperature range.
- Material Compatibility: Ensure that the bearing material is suitable for the environment in which it will operate.
5. What maintenance is required for high speed motor journal bearings?
To ensure long-lasting performance of high speed motor journal bearings, adhere to these maintenance practices:
- Regular Inspections: Check for signs of wear, misalignment, or damage.
- Lubrication: Apply appropriate lubricants regularly to minimize friction and wear.
- Temperature Monitoring: Keep an eye on operating temperatures to detect any abnormalities.
- Replacement: Replace bearings at the end of their service life to avoid unexpected failures.
